The Significance of the NAR Statement 02.11.2022

On October 10, 2022, a five page statement was released online titled NAR and Christian Nationalism Statement. Dr. Michael Brown and Joseph Mattera were said to have co-drafted this document. A handful of signatures from known leaders in the Charismatic movement were noted on the statement, along with a few hundred ministers to date. New Prophecy in the 2nd Century and Beyond 19.10.2022

In the middle of the second century, a man by the name of Montanus arrived in Phrygia and began displaying ecstatic utterances alongside two women who ultimately left their husbands to participate as prophetesses of what would be called the New Prophecy.
